Output 620314a21c6000587616e28aa463835cff0af3121f5063f61bd9868899c39a5a:8
- value
- 311392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9536e49615324e5944a3702bd7a4968fff6b11a5 OP_EQUAL
- address
- 3FHzN9qFUC8yMeoFswNegbxZiMZbxNa8uT
- transaction
- 620314a21c6000587616e28aa463835cff0af3121f5063f61bd9868899c39a5a
- spent
- true